Role of Chyawanprash in the prevention of COVID-19 in health care workers

Evaluation of protective potential of an Ayurvedic Rasayan (Chyawanprash) in the prevention of COVID-19 among Health Care Personnel â?? An open label, prospective Randomized controlled parallel group study

Interventions

Intervention1: Ayurveda Rasayana along with conventional guidelines for health care workers.: Chyawanprash-12 g twice daily. Dosage form : Avaleha (Jam like

Eligibility

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1) All healthcare professionals and staff of age group between 25 to 60 years willing to participate, negative for SARS- Cov-2 at screening,(tested by rt-PCR) without co-morbid condition

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1) Pregnant and lactating females. 2) Immune compromised and co morbid condition cases. 3)Laboratory confirmed COVID-19 with or without symptoms 4)Known allergy to any of the medications used in this trial. 5) Subjects who are taking any other medicine as prophylaxis such as HCQ.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Percentage of participants with SARS- Cov-2 positivity as estimated by RT-PCR of nasopharyngeal swabTimepoint: baseline Day 30

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Safety profile of the intervention as estimated by LFT, KFT and other haematological & biochemical investigations. Presence or absence of AE/ADR. Number of participants who developed any infective diseases during the trial period (bacterial /viral/ fungal / etc.) and percentage of participants with Upper respiratory tract illness during the period. Timepoint: baseline Day 7 Day 15 Day 30
